 Definitions of crawler  [ˈkrɔ lər]  

Translate crawler to



Definition of 'crawler' Random House Webster's College Dictionary 

1. (n.) crawler
one that crawls.

2.  crawler
Also called crawler tractor. a large, heavy vehicle that travels on endless belts or tracks, used esp. in construction.

Etymology:  (1640–50)

Definition of 'crawler' Princeton's WordNet 

1. (noun) sycophant, toady, crawler, lackey, ass-kisser
a person who tries to please someone in order to gain a personal advantage

2. (noun) crawler, creeper
a person who crawls or creeps along the ground

3. (noun) earthworm, angleworm, fishworm, fishing worm, wiggler, nightwalker, nightcrawler, crawler, dew worm, red worm
terrestrial worm that burrows into and helps aerate soil; often surfaces when the ground is cool or wet; used as bait by anglers


Definition of 'crawler' Webster Dictionary 

1. (noun) crawler
one who, or that which, crawls; a creeper; a reptile
